Newmont Corporation (TSX:NGT) is a multinational gold producer operating across several continents. The company’s portfolio spans exploration, development, and production phases. It holds active mining operations and assets in North America, South America, Australia, and Africa. Alongside gold, it also explores for copper, silver, lead, and zinc.

Geographic Diversification of Mining Assets

The company maintains active exploration and production projects in regions such as Canada, the United States, Mexico, Argentina, Chile, Ghana, Ecuador, Papua New Guinea, and others.
